WebOct 3, 2024 · What instrument is used to measure clouds? ceilometer A ceilometer is a device that uses a laser or other light source to determine the height of a cloud ceiling or a cloud base from the ground. Ceilometers can also be used to measure the aerosol concentration within the atmosphere. How do we measure clouds? In meteorology, …

WebAnswer (1 of 2): Cloud cover on the visible sky, also known as 'the celestial dome' is measured in octas: That is in eighths. If the whole sky is overcast with one type of cloud it would be eight eighths cloud cover. But each of any different type of cloud is estimated in the same way so an obser...
